Uşak is becoming the center of recycling of textile wastes while expanding its domestic and international export area. Uşak is becoming the center of recycling of textile wastes while expanding its domestic and international export area. Usak, which has a wide market especially in European countries, 85 percent meet the needs of the textile recycling in Turkey. On the other hand, thousands of people are being employed, especially women's employment in the expanding business area in the region. The region, which has hundreds of companies in the field of tekstil textile waste recycling du where the biggest contribution is made to the city economy, is expanding its domestic and foreign markets gradually. A new research project at the Hohenstein Group deals with antimicrobial effects of Lewis acids that are applied on textile surfaces. Results of this work may significantly contribute to countermeasures against multi-resistant bacteria as found, for example, in medical facilities. Many areas of everyday and professional life require antimicrobial protection. Such an effect on textile surfaces is currently achieved by utilization of silver or ammonium containing compounds. However, the use of such compounds is questionable with respect to possible adverse ecological and toxicological effects. In addition, these compounds are generally expensive. The French Textile Machinery Manufacturers are the sixth textile machinery exporter worldwide. They have a total annual consolidated turnover of 1 billion Euros. They are the sixth textile machinery exporter worldwide. They are particularly strong in long fibre spinning (wool, acrylic …), yarn twisting and control (including technical yarns), space-dyeing, heat setting for carpet yarns, carpet systems, dyeing and finishing, felts and belts for finishing processes, nonwovens, air conditioning of textile plants and recycling processes of textile materials.
